Condividi tramite


Funzione WdfRegistryClose (wdfregistry.h)

[Si applica a KMDF e UMDF]

Il metodo WdfRegistryClose chiude la chiave del Registro di sistema associata a un oggetto chiave del Registro di sistema del framework specificato e quindi elimina l'oggetto chiave del Registro di sistema.

Sintassi

void WdfRegistryClose(
  [in] WDFKEY Key
);

Parametri

[in] Key

Handle di un oggetto chiave del Registro di sistema che rappresenta una chiave del Registro di sistema aperta.

Valore restituito

Nessuno

Osservazioni:

Se il driver fornisce un handle di oggetto non valido, si verifica un controllo di bug.

Al termine dell'accesso a una chiave del Registro di sistema, il driver deve chiamare WdfRegistryClose o WdfObjectDelete. Entrambi questi metodi chiudono la chiave del Registro di sistema ed eliminano l'oggetto chiave del Registro di sistema.

Per altre informazioni sugli oggetti chiave del Registro di sistema, vedere Using the Registry in Framework-Based Drivers.

Esempi

L'esempio di codice seguente chiude una chiave del Registro di sistema ed elimina l'oggetto chiave del Registro di sistema.

WdfRegistryClose(Key);

Requisiti

Requisito Valore
Piattaforma di destinazione Universale
versione minima di KMDF 1.0
versione minima di UMDF 2.0
intestazione wdfregistry.h (include Wdf.h)
Biblioteca Wdf01000.sys (KMDF); WUDFx02000.dll (UMDF)
IRQL PASSIVE_LEVEL
regole di conformità DDI DriverCreate(kmdf), KmdfIrql(kmdf), KmdfIrql2(kmdf), KmdfIrqlExplicit(kmdf)

Vedere anche

WdfObjectDelete